Bund |
1. n. (politics) alliance, federation, league | |
2. n. (biblical) covenant | |
3. n. (music) fret (of a guitar) | |
Gitarrenbund | |
4. n. waistband | |
5. n. bunch | |
ein Bund Rosen - a bunch of roses | |
6. n. (German politics) confederation of German states | |
Die Aufgaben des Bundes - The tasks of the German confederation | |
7. n. (informal, Germany) short for, Bundeswehr, (German army) | |
Ich geh’ zum Bund. - I will join the German army. | |

Zwei |
1. n-f. two (digit or figure) | |
Die Zwei ist die einzige gerade Primzahl. - Two is the only even prime number. | |
Die Zahl 22 besteht aus zwei Zweien. - The number 22 consists of two 2s. | |
Ich werf' dauernd Zweien! - I’m always throwing twos! (in dice) | |
2. n-f. (Germany) an academic grade indicating "good", corresponding roughly to a B in English-speaking countries | |
Die gute Nachricht: Ich habe eine Zwei in Englisch! - The good news: I got a B in English! | |
3. num. (cardinal) two (numerical value represented by the Arabic numeral 2; or describing a set with two components) | |

Partei |
1. n-f. (politics) political party | |
2. n-f. (legal) party (person, company, or institution) participating in a legal action or contract | |
3. Proper noun. A party in a given one-party system, especially | |
4. Proper noun. the NSDAP of Nazi Germany | |
5. Proper noun. the SED of Communist Germany | |
Mein Opa war in der Partei. - My Grandad was a Party member. | |
